Publications on prescription fire:

Caldwell . T.G., D. W. Johnson, W. W. Miller, and R. G. Qualls. 2002. Forest Floor Carbon and Nitrogen Losses Due to Prescription Fire. Soil Sci. Soc. Amer. J. 66:262-267.

Murphy, J.D., D.W. Johnson, W.W. Miller, R.F. Walker, and R.R. Blank. Prescribed fire effects on forest floor and soil nutrients in a Sierra Nevada ecosystem. Soil Science 171: 181-199.

Prescription Fire Study Sites

Truckee Ranger District - Prescription Fire:
Vegetation: Jeffrey Pine, light understory
Soils: Jorge series, Typic Cryoboralfs derived from andesite

North Lake Tahoe - Prescription Fire:

Vegetation: Mixed conifer
Soils: Tahoma series, fine-loamy, mixed, Typic Cryoboralfs derived from volcanic rock
